News on Jesse Robredo: Debris Found at Crash Site
« on: August 20, 2012, 08:26:53 PM »
Foreign diver Matthew Reed of Evolution Resort from Malapasqua Island in Cebu found debris at the crash site of the Piper Seneca plane carrying Interior and Local Government Secretary Jesse Robredo and two pilots in the waters off Masbate City last Saturday afternoon.

”Matt of Evolution Dives Cebu reports dispersed debris found 180-210 feet, roughly 2.5 km from shore,” Roxas said in his Twitter account.

Roxas said Reed videoed the debris which are now being analyzed by the government search and rescue operations group.

He said the four-man technical divers of the Philippine Navy confirmed the debris in the same area as mentioned by the foreign diver.

”Four-man navy tech divers just returned too. They confirmed debris field in same area as Matt + 30 feet. Glass pieces of cockpit. They marked it,” Roxas said. - pna
